The Greek Left Alliance (ELAS) is unveiling the people who will stand alongside Alexis Tsipras on the road to the ballot box. These are the 400+1 members who make up the National Council of ELAS, each bringing distinct professional, academic, and social backgrounds.
As senior party figures from the Amalias Street headquarters put it: “This new political endeavor must be built from society and speak to society. It must give space and voice to people who know firsthand the challenges of everyday life, work, production, science, and social engagement. This is not a traditional party structure that reproduces closed mechanisms and old hierarchies. It is an open field of participation, where people with different experiences and starting points come together with a shared goal: to contribute to shaping a new political vision for the country.”
The National Council brings together students and young scientists, workers and professionals, farmers, entrepreneurs, economists, trade unionists, local government officials, healthcare workers, educators, artists, and athletes, as well as active citizens engaged in their local communities. These are people who understand the country’s problems — but also its potential. They are called upon to channel their experience into crafting political solutions with a social dimension. Youth participation is a central pillar of this initiative. Students, young scientists, and members of the educational community are actively involved in a project that seeks to bridge experience with fresh ideas, and today’s needs with tomorrow’s aspirations.
